Responses published

4 of 7 (57%) have at least one response published on judiciary.uk.

This counts responses published against the report by anyone, not whether a particular body replied. Publication is at the Chief Coroner's discretion and was far less consistent in the corpus's early years, so read a low figure as a prompt to open the reports, not as a finding.
